Russel Metals Inc. (RUS) — Cash Flow Quality Index
Russel Metals Inc. (RUS) has a Cash Flow Quality Index of 3.47x as of December 2025. Operating cash flow of CA$105.40 Million exceeds net income of CA$30.40 Million, indicating high earnings quality where cash backs reported profits. Annual Cash Flow Quality Index for Russel Metals Inc. (1995–2025)

| Year | Quality Index | Operating CF (CAD) | Net Income | YoY Change |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 2025 | 1.18x | CA$199.50 Million | CA$168.80 Million | ▼ -44.7% |
| 2024 | 2.14x | CA$343.90 Million | CA$161.00 Million | ▲ +23.4% |
| 2023 | 1.73x | CA$461.70 Million | CA$266.70 Million | ▲ +78.9% |
| 2022 | 0.97x | CA$359.90 Million | CA$371.90 Million | ▲ +37.4% |
| 2021 | 0.70x | CA$304.50 Million | CA$432.20 Million | ▼ -95.3% |
| 2020 | 15.14x | CA$371.00 Million | CA$24.50 Million | ▲ +364.5% |
| 2019 | 3.26x | CA$249.70 Million | CA$76.60 Million | ▲ +712.2% |
| 2018 | 0.40x | CA$87.90 Million | CA$219.00 Million | ▲ +172.6% |
| 2017 | -0.55x | CA$-68.40 Million | CA$123.80 Million | ▼ -120.2% |
| 2016 | 2.74x | CA$172.00 Million | CA$62.80 Million | ▲ +1104.7% |
| 2014 | 0.23x | CA$28.10 Million | CA$123.60 Million | ▼ -86.6% |
| 2013 | 1.70x | CA$141.70 Million | CA$83.30 Million | ▲ +121.1% |
| 2012 | 0.77x | CA$76.00 Million | CA$98.80 Million | ▲ +61.9% |
| 2011 | 0.48x | CA$56.20 Million | CA$118.30 Million | ▼ -59.0% |
| 2010 | 1.16x | CA$80.70 Million | CA$69.70 Million | ▲ +367.4% |
| 2008 | 0.25x | CA$56.60 Million | CA$228.50 Million | ▼ -87.1% |
| 2007 | 1.92x | CA$210.70 Million | CA$109.60 Million | ▲ +20433.2% |
| 2006 | -0.01x | CA$-1.50 Million | CA$158.70 Million | ▼ -100.9% |
| 2005 | 1.09x | CA$135.84 Million | CA$124.78 Million | ▲ +2772.8% |
| 2004 | 0.04x | CA$6.85 Million | CA$180.77 Million | ▼ -99.5% |
| 2003 | 7.90x | CA$152.28 Million | CA$19.29 Million | ▲ +770.4% |
| 2002 | 0.91x | CA$26.52 Million | CA$29.24 Million | ▼ -91.6% |
| 2001 | 10.82x | CA$93.14 Million | CA$8.61 Million | ▲ +5041.7% |
| 2000 | -0.22x | CA$-5.23 Million | CA$23.90 Million | ▼ -106.5% |
| 1999 | 3.36x | CA$140.70 Million | CA$41.90 Million | ▲ +192.7% |
| 1998 | 1.15x | CA$46.00 Million | CA$40.10 Million | ▲ +343.0% |
| 1997 | -0.47x | CA$-14.40 Million | CA$30.50 Million | ▼ -105.3% |
| 1995 | 8.96x | CA$65.40 Million | CA$7.30 Million | — |
